Abstract

PARA LA FABRICACION A GRAN ESCALA DE UNA CAPA RECUBRIDORA MARRON (PATINA MARRON) HOMOGENEA Y MUY ADHESIVA SOBRE SUPERFICIES DE SEMIPRODUCTOS DE COBRE, ESPECIALMENTE SOBRE BANDAS Y CHAPAS LAMINADAS PARA LA CONSTRUCCION, EL PROCEDIMIENTO PREVEE RASPAR PRIMERO LA SUPERFICIE DEL SEMIPRODUCTO DE COBRE MEDIANTE UN TRATAMIENTO MECANICO, SOMETIENDO, A CONTINUACION, EL SEMIPRODUCTO A UN TRATAMIENTO TERMICO A UNA TEMPERATURA ENTRE 150 Y 650 GRADOS C Y DURANTE 0,1 ENVEJECIMIENTO EN FABRICA, SIN QUE HAYA QUE ESPERAR QUE SE PRODUZCA EL CAMBIO AL COLOR MARRON DE LA SUPERFICIE ORIGINADO A LARGO PLAZO POR LAS INFLUENCIAS ATMOSFERICAS. PARA MEJORAR LA ADHESIVIDAD DE LA PATINA MARRON, EL SEMIPRODUCTO DE COBRE PUEDE SOMETERSE A UNA POSTOXIDACION QUIMICA DESPUES DEL TRATAMIENTO TERMICO.
